Figure 2: Physical characterization of the representative MOAs.

(a) SEM of AlBTC-1:1-0.40 (bar width=500 nm). (b) TEM of AlBTC-3:2-0.075 (scale bar, 100 nm; the insert shows digital photograph of gel before subcritical extraction). (c) PXRD patterns of AlBDC-3:2-0.15 wet gel obtained in EtOH at 353 K (I), AlBDC-3:2-0.15 aerogel (II), intermediate obtained from AlBDC-3:2-0.15 reaction systems in EtOH at 333 K (III) and 323 K (IV), and simulation from the single-crystal data of MIL-53(Al) in its LP form (V). (d) 27Al MAS NMR spectral ex situ monitoring of AlBDC-3:2-0.15 system at different gelation times in comparison with pure Al(NO3)3·9H2O, MIL-53(Al) solid in LP form and their mixtures.
